### Buy Tokens
```python

from solders.pubkey import Pubkey
from solana.rpc.api import Client
from solders.keypair import Keypair
â€‹
import solcoin.buy_tokens as buy
â€‹
PUBLIC_KEY = "your_account_pubkey_string" # ex:G3tmXiWmgnhhjb4N12YK7QgmaqtRaCRaL6i4nx2ueKwr
TOKEN_MINT = "token_mint_string" # ex:6oDn2PDvjtKYoWVp9cNNe1WCepjS8VQzhBRS8qmXpump
mint_pubkey = Pubkey.from_string(TOKEN_MINT)
client = Client("your_RPC_url") # ex:https://api.mainnet-beta.solana.com
â€‹
tokensOrSolAmount = .1 # how many tokens or sol you want to purchase
tokensOrSol = 'sol' # either 'token' or 'sol', whichever unit you want to buy in
SLIPPAGE_PERCENT = 20
PRIORITY_FEE = .000001 
â€‹
private_key_base58 = "private_key_base58_string" # your base58 private key string
payer_keypair = Keypair.from_base58_string(private_key_base58)
â€‹
â€‹
sig, status = buy.purchase_token(mint_pubkey, client, tokensOrSolAmount, tokensOrSol, SLIPPAGE_PERCENT, PUBLIC_KEY, payer_keypair, PRIORITY_FEE, analytics=True)
â€‹
print(sig) # prints the signature of the transaction
print(status) # prints the current status of the transaction
```

### Sell Tokens
```python
from solders.pubkey import Pubkey
from solana.rpc.api import Client
from solders.keypair import Keypair

import solcoin.sell_tokens as sell

PUBLIC_KEY = "your_account_pubkey_string" # ex:G3tmXiWmgnhhjb4N12YK7QgmaqtRaCRaL6i4nx2ueKwr
TOKEN_MINT = "token_mint_string" # ex:6oDn2PDvjtKYoWVp9cNNe1WCepjS8VQzhBRS8qmXpump
mint_pubkey = Pubkey.from_string(TOKEN_MINT)
client = Client("your_RPC_url") # ex:https://api.mainnet-beta.solana.com

tokensOrSolAmount = 100 # how many tokens or sol or percent of coins you own you want to purchase
tokensOrSol = 'percent' # either 'token' or 'sol' or 'percent, whichever unit you want to buy in
SLIPPAGE_PERCENT = 20
PRIORITY_FEE = .000001 

private_key_base58 = "private_key_base58_string" # your base58 private key string
payer_keypair = Keypair.from_base58_string(private_key_base58)


sig, status = sell.sell_token(mint_pubkey, client, tokensOrSolAmount, tokensOrSol, SLIPPAGE_PERCENT, PUBLIC_KEY, payer_keypair, PRIORITY_FEE, analytics=True)


print(sig) # prints the signature of the transaction
print(status) # prints the current status of the transaction
```
